Reimbursement for Tax Savings Sample Clauses

Reimbursement for Tax Savings. If (x) a Tax Indemnitee or any Affiliate thereof realizes a deduction, offset, credit or refund of any Taxes or any other savings or benefit as a result of any indemnity paid by the Lessee pursuant to this Section 26.5 or (y) by reason of the incurrence or imposition of any Tax (or the circumstances or event giving rise thereto) for which a Tax Indemnitee is indemnified hereunder or any payment made to or for the account of such Tax Indemnitee by the Lessee pursuant to this Section 26.5 or any payment made by a Tax Indemnitee to the Lessee by reason of this Section 26.5(c), such Tax Indemnitee at any time actually realizes a reduction in any Taxes for which the Lessee is not required to indemnify such Tax Indemnitee pursuant to this Section 26.5 which reduction in Taxes was not taken into account in computing such payment by the Lessee to or for the account of such Tax Indemnitee or by the Tax Indemnitee to the Lessee, then such Tax Indemnitee shall promptly pay to the Lessee (xx) the amount of such deduction, offset, credit, refund, or other savings or benefit together with the amount of any interest received by such Tax Indemnitee on account of such deduction, offset, credit, refund or other savings or benefit or (yy) an amount equal to such reduction in Taxes, as the case may be, in either case together with an amount equal to any reduced Taxes payable by such Tax Indemnitee as a result of such payment; provided that no such payment shall be made so long as a Default or Event of Default shall have occurred and be continuing but shall be paid promptly after cure of such Default or Event of Default. Each Tax Indemnitee agrees to take such actions as the Lessee may reasonably request (provided in the good faith judgment of the Tax Indemnitee, such actions would not result in a material adverse effect on the Tax Indemnitee for which the Tax Indemnitee is not entitled to indemnification from the Lessee) and to otherwise act in good faith to claim such refunds and other available Tax benefits, and take such other actions as may be reasonable to minimize any payment due from the Lessee pursuant to this Section 26.5 and to maximize the amount of any Tax savings available to it. Reimbursement for Tax Savings. If (x) a Tax Indemnitee shall obtain a credit or refund of any Taxes paid by the Lessee pursuant to this Section 7.4 or (y) by reason of the incurrence or imposition of any Tax for which a Tax Indemnitee is indemnified hereunder or any payment made to or for the account of such Tax Indemnitee by the Lessee pursuant to this Section 7.4, such Tax Indemnitee at any time realizes a reduction in any Taxes for which the Lessee is not required to indemnify such Tax Indemnitee pursuant to this Section 7.4, which reduction in Taxes was not taken into account in computing such payment by the Lessee to or for the account of such Tax Indemnitee, then such Tax Indemnitee shall promptly pay to the Lessee (xx) the amount of such credit or refund, together with the amount of any interest received by such Tax Indemnitee on account of such credit or refund or (yy) an amount equal to such reduction in Taxes, as the case may be; provided that no such payment shall be made so long as an Event of Default shall have occurred and be continuing and, provided, further, that the amount payable to the Lessee by any Tax Indemnitee pursuant to this Section 7.4(d) shall not at any time exceed the aggregate amount of all indemnity payments made by the Lessee under this Section 7.4 to such Tax Indemnitee with respect to the Taxes which gave rise to the credit or refund or with respect to the Tax which gave rise

  • Tax Reimbursement (a) Anything in this Agreement to the contrary notwithstanding, in the event it shall be determined that any payments or distributions by Ceridian to or for the benefit of Executive (whether paid or payable or distributed or distributable pursuant to the terms of this Agreement or otherwise, but determined without regard to any payments required under this Section 7.04) (collectively, the "Payments") would be subject to the excise tax imposed by Section 4999 of the Code or any interest or penalties are incurred by Executive with respect to such excise tax (such excise tax, together with any such interest and penalties, are hereinafter collectively referred to as the "Excise Tax"), then Executive shall be entitled to receive an additional payment (a "Gross-Up Payment") in an amount such that, after payment by Executive of all taxes (and any interest or penalties imposed with respect to such taxes), including any income taxes and Excise Tax imposed upon the Gross-Up Payment, Executive retains an amount of the Gross-Up Payment equal to the Excise Tax imposed upon the Payments.
